I walk through the main house on my way back home, hoping to run into my mom to give her the Tupperware of spaghetti Iâm holding instead of just tossing it into the fridge. I need to check on her, find what sheâs thinking after the confession I put into Dadâs head, which I know is now in hers. It wouldnât be out of character for Dad to transfer whatever words he wouldâve had for me to her, especially now. Create a source for another one of their arguments.
I find her in the kitchen, crying over the emptied sink. Her pain is more uninhibited now that Iâm not around as much to see, her back caving and shoulders jerking with each sob. The ache in my chest at seeing the ache in Momâs turns to my clenched fists around the Tupperware.
Where the fuck are you, Dad? He should be here for her, taking his wife in his arms as she breaks down because of him.
Because of me?
âMom?â My voice is low enough not to startle, but she jerks anyway, sniffing in all of her emotion as she turns to me and wipes her face.
âOh, hi, honey.â She turns back to the sink to run a wetted hand over her cheeks. âHow long have you been there?â I slide the Tupperware along the counter, freeing my hands to wrap her into a hug. âOh, Iâm fine,â she says as she leans into my hold and holds me back. âAnyone ever tell you you give the best hugs?â
I smile and give her a squeeze, pulling back to point out the spaghetti, get that out of the way. âFrom Camille and Julian.â
Mom smiles at the Tupperware, but it fades as she wipes more tears.
âIs it me or Dad?â I ask, and her eyes spring up to mine, her deep inhale expelling in a sigh.
âItâs just life, Tommy.â
âBut Dad told you what I told him?â
She gives me a slight nod, and prefaces the rest of this conversation with, âThe last thing I want is to sound like Ashby.â This is where my refereeing comes from. Mom has been mine and Dadâs. âIâm just worried about your future. And so is your dad.â
âDadâs worried about my basketball future,â I clarify. âParticularly making sure thatâs what it is.â
âAnd youâre not happy anymore? You donât love basketball?â Momâs eyes study me through concern. I see the worry, but thereâs no judgment, which softens me and makes me say my next words.
âI love Reyna.â Thereâs a sad defeat in my voice that makes Mom squeeze one of my hands. My love for Reyna is the only thing Iâm sure of and even she feels out of reach.
